Taxonomy
Terebratula teres was named by Bohm (1903).

It was recombined as Aulacothyroides teres by Dagys (1974).

Composition: low Mg calcitep
Environment: marineuc
Locomotion: stationaryf
Attached: yesp
Life habit: low-level epifaunalf
Diet: suspension feederf
Vision: blindc
